Job description

The Data Engineer role is a new position created to reflect the rapid growth of the business.

We are looking for a skilled AWS Data Engineer to take ownership of our existing cloud-based data infrastructure and evolve it into a best-practice, scalable, and business-critical platform. You will be responsible for refining and expanding our AWS-based data ecosystem, ensuring it supports the organisation’s growing analytical and reporting needs across Development, Finance, Operations, and beyond.

This is a hands‑on role where you will define technical direction, embed best practices, and drive data quality, efficiency, and cost optimisation across the platform.

Job requirements
  • Strong hands‑on experience with AWS data services (e.g., S3, Glue, Lambda, Athena, Redshift, DynamoDB).
  • Strong hands‑on experience with data visualisation tools such as QuickSight.
  • Proficiency in Python for data processing, API integration, and automation.
  • Strong SQL skills for data extraction and transformation.
  • Experience working with REST APIs and JSON data structures.
  • Practical experience with GitLab (version control, branching, and CI/CD pipelines).
  • Solid understanding of data pipeline design and ETL best practices.
  • Experience with infrastructure as code (e.g., Terraform or CloudFormation).
  • Advantageous to have: Knowledge of SalesForce and/or Sage Intacct data flow.
  • Identify and implement improvements to our current data infrastructure, be it cost optimisation or adherence to best practice.
  • Collaborate with business stakeholders – including Development, Finance, and Product teams – to identify new data opportunities and translate requirements into practical solutions.
  • Design, build, and maintain data ingestion, transformation pipelines and visualisations using AWS services (e.g., S3, Glue, Lambda, Athena, Redshift, Step Functions, QuickSight).
  • Develop Python scripts and ETL processes for data processing and automation.
  • Integrate data from various APIs and third‑party sources into cloud‑based data systems.
  • Write and optimise SQL queries for data extraction, transformation, and validation.
  • Use GitLab for version control, CI/CD, and collaborative development.
  • Implement best practices for data quality, scalability, and security.
  • Monitor and control data platform costs.
